Alina Habba’s Education
Alina Habba’s legal foundation was solidified through her rigorous academic pursuits, which culminated in her law degree from Widener University Commonwealth Law School. Following her graduation, she honed her legal skills and knowledge by serving as a law clerk to Eugene J. Codey Jr., who was the Presiding Judge of the Civil Superior Court in Essex County, New Jersey, from 2010 to 2011.
This pivotal experience provided Habba with invaluable courtroom exposure and a deeper understanding of legal proceedings. Her educational journey played a critical role in shaping her into the proficient attorney she is today, leading her to become the managing partner of Habba, Madaio & Associates LLP.
Alina Habba’s Family
Alina Habba grew up in a tight-knit family environment in Summit, New Jersey, alongside her two siblings. Her parents, devout Catholics, made the brave decision to leave Iraq and settle in the United States during the early 1980s.
This move was motivated by a desire to escape the persecution they faced in their homeland. The resilience and courage of her parents not only provided Alina and her siblings with a safer life but also instilled in them the value of perseverance and the importance of standing firm in one’s beliefs.
Alina Habba Husband
Gregg Reuben, the spouse of Alina Habba, is an accomplished entrepreneur with a notable background. A Harvard Business School graduate, Reuben is at the helm of Centerpark, a company that specializes in parking management systems in New York City.
His expertise spans over two and a half decades in this niche, showcasing a deep understanding and innovative approach to parking solutions. Beyond his business acumen, Reuben dedicates time to philanthropy, volunteering at The Bowery Mission, reflecting his commitment to giving back to the community.

Alina Habba’s Career
Alina Saad Habba has made a significant mark in the legal industry as the managing partner of Habba, Madaio & Associates LLP. Based in Bedminster, New Jersey, and with an additional office in New York City, her firm handles a variety of cases, showcasing Habba’s wide-ranging legal expertise.
Her prominent role as a legal spokesperson for Donald Trump, coupled with her senior advisory position for MAGA, Inc., highlights her influence in political and legal spheres. Alina Habba & Reuben’s Net Worth
The financial revelations surrounding Gregg Reuben and Alina Habba have sparked widespread curiosity about their net worth, especially in light of recent financial challenges. Reuben and his LLCs face over $770,000 in active state tax warrants and liens, with significant amounts documented from 2016 through 2022.
Meanwhile, Habba and her firm face smaller yet notable liens amounting to a few thousand dollars. However, their Net Worth is estimated to be 2 million to 5 million dollars.
